Peer Ministry Leadership Team
Comprised of ten juniors and seniors, the Peer Ministry Leadership Team seeks to lead, inspire and invite the Notre Dame community to the experience of faith. Encouraged by the values of spirituality, community, and ministry, these young women will offer love, companionship and hospitality to the community, so that all can explore their spirituality with openness and encouragement. Interested students may apply for this executive level leadership experience in the Spring.
Gifts, Spirituality and Leadership
As a Religious Studies elective course and team-taught by Campus Ministers, this semester course explores a student’s potential for peer ministry. Students will learn the foundations of liturgical theology and retreat planning as well as the ministry skills needed to implement liturgies and retreats successfully. In the planning and implementation of one liturgical celebration and the Breakaway Days, students will develop an awareness of their own personal gifts, spirituality and leadership abilities in service of the community. Exploration of how these skills and experiences extend to other areas of student life will also be included. This course is required for any student wishing to serve as a retreat leader or liturgical planner.
